Transaction f7d4de817fd1406948149d2bcc2ae504e30ffe20671cd8a88c2c73c11199d3ed
2 Input
2 Outputs
- f7d4de817fd1406948149d2bcc2ae504e30ffe20671cd8a88c2c73c11199d3ed:0
- f7d4de817fd1406948149d2bcc2ae504e30ffe20671cd8a88c2c73c11199d3ed:1
value 1232529
address 1KcUUDDPLmu6CSGcgRifM168u3HE7Ysfb
value 16417600
address 1Kf3D3YFybEpah9sVaymBfAQGTes2yR8du